At Dementia NI our members, all of whom are living with a diagnosis of dementia, are at the heart of our organisation. With them, we work to challenge the stigma of a dementia diagnosis and help people with dementia across Northern Ireland to have their voices heard.

We are now recruiting for the post of Donor Engagement Assistant within our fundraising team.

Responsible to: Head of Engagement
Location: Belfast office with flexibility for home working 1-2 days a week
Hours: 30 - 37.5 hours per week (to be agreed with the successful candidate)
Salary: £27,770 per annum (FTE/Point 1 on scale)

This is an exciting time to join Dementia NI. As a local dynamic charity, our profile and impact continue to grow, attracting interest and securing support from a wide and diverse range of donors.

As Donor Engagement Assistant, you will build meaningful connections with supporters and create a welcoming experience from the very first interaction. You will guide donors throughout their fundraising journey, helping drive our success and deliver our vision of everyone living well with dementia.

You will also be the main point of contact for our fundraising volunteers, ensuring they have opportunities to stay engaged and are supported and recognised for the valuable contribution they make.
